H19 SPS is a 1999 Honda Cr-v in Gold with a 1,973c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.5%.
Across all 1999 Honda Cr-v models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.9% with a typical mileage of 103,487 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Honda Cr-v f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 62,925 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H19 SPS,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da Cr-v typ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 27 years old, this Honda Cr-v is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
